牛津词典

    pron.

    • 他们;她们;它们
      used when referring to people, animals or things as the object of a verb or preposition, or after the verb be
      1. Tell them the news.
        把这消息告诉他们。
      2. What are you doing with those matches? Give them to me.
        你拿那些火柴做什么?把它们交给我。
      3. Did you eat all of them?
        你都吃光了吗?
      4. It's them.
        是他们。
    • (指性别不详的人时,用以代替him或her)
      used instead of him or her to refer to a person whose sex is not mentioned or not known
      1. If anyone comes in before I get back, ask them to wait.
        如果在我回来之前有人来,就请他等一等。

    柯林斯词典

      Them is a third person plural pronoun. Them is used as the object of a verb or preposition. them 是第三人称复数代词,用作动词或介词的宾语。

    • PRON-PLURAL 他们;她们;它们
      You usethemto refer to a group of people, animals, or things.
      1. The Beatles — I never get tired of listening to them...
        甲壳虫乐队——我是百听不厌。
      2. Kids these days have no one to tell them what's right and wrong...
        如今的孩子没人告诉他们什么是对什么是错。
      3. She let the dogs into the house and fed them...
        她把狗放进屋,给它们喂食。
      4. His dark socks, I could see, had a stripe on them.
        我能看出他的深色袜子上有道条纹。
    • PRON-PLURAL (代替 him or her,而不指明是男是女;有人认为这种用法不对)
      You usetheminstead of 'him or her' to refer to a person without saying whether that person is a man or a woman. Some people think this use is incorrect.
      1. It takes great courage to face your child and tell them the truth.
        面对自己的孩子,告诉他们真相是需要很大勇气的。
    • DET 那些(不规范口语中代替those)
      In non-standard spoken English,themis sometimes used instead of 'those'.
      1. 'Our Billy doesn't eat them ones,' Helen said.
        “咱家比利不吃那些东西,”海伦说。
